首页
学习
活动
专区
圈层
工具
发布
社区首页 >问答首页 >与来自雅虎财经的IMPORTDATA连接

与来自雅虎财经的IMPORTDATA连接
EN

Stack Overflow用户
提问于 2016-07-15 06:59:59
回答 1查看 608关注 0票数 1

为了使多个数据库中的公司名称标准化,我发现我可以用Yahoo finance API交叉引用公司名称,并在所有方面获得一致的名称。

我正在使用

代码语言:javascript
复制
=Transpose(ImportData("http://finance.yahoo.com/d/quotes.csv?s="&A2&"&f=n"))

但这会将每个单词分隔到不同的列中,因此我必须使用以下代码将另一列中的输出连接起来:

代码语言:javascript
复制
=TRIM(CONCATENATE(F2," ",G2," ",H2," ",I2," ",J2," ",V2))

有没有办法一气呵成呢?我试过使用"min",它只输出"0“。有什么想法?我很感谢你的帮助。

EN

回答 1

Stack Overflow用户

回答已采纳

发布于 2016-07-16 00:24:58

使用join连接importdata的输出。转置变得不必要了,因为join也可以处理列。

代码语言:javascript
复制
=join(" ", ImportData("http://finance.yahoo.com/d/quotes.csv?s="&A2&"&f=s"))

或者,如果您需要在最后对其进行修剪(在示例中似乎没有必要),

代码语言:javascript
复制
=trim(join(" ", ImportData("http://finance.yahoo.com/d/quotes.csv?s="&A2&"&f=s")))
票数 1
EN
页面原文内容由Stack Overflow提供。腾讯云小微IT领域专用引擎提供翻译支持
原文链接:

https://stackoverflow.com/questions/38385520

复制
相关文章

相似问题

领券
问题归档专栏文章快讯文章归档关键词归档开发者手册归档开发者手册 Section 归档